Studying Othello and Gatsby (English Lang + Lit, Edexcel/Pearson) and I’m trying to come up with example comparison points for different themes that overlap but I’m struggling a bit with the themes below. I aim for 3 comparison points each. Would appreciate any help x

Theme: Friendship
I watched an Othello conference and they spoke about how at the start, the friendships between women are weakest but at the end they are strongest (Emilia initially lies to D about the handkerchief and she doesn’t support Bianca against accusations of prostitution but at the end, Emilia dies for D). Not sure if this idea can be incorporated or not? If not, I’ll take advice for other comparison points

Theme: Ambition

Theme: Reputation/Status

Theme: Change

Themes are for both


OTHELLO:
Ambition = Iago duh & how his revenge turns into all tragedy possibilities (domestic, political & revenge), Cassio with getting his job back after being demoted, Emilia challenging typical gender roles
Reputation: Othello once he believes he’s cuckholded & in his final monologue, Cassio once he loses his job (“reputation, reputation, reputation” “everlasting part of myself”), Settings!!
Change: Emilia throughout becoming more loyal to D, Othello & D relationship, Settings!!

GATSBY:
Ambition = Gatsby & Myrtle affairs with Old Money folk to change their status (links to reputation too), Jordan being the only one with a career in the old money group
Reputation = Gatsby’s parties and house, Jordan cheating in her career, Daisy in Chicago prior to her marriage
Change = Time & pathetic fallacy!!
